Biography

Chris Kirker is a Texas trial lawyer handling highly contested divorce and custody matters. Chris has been successfully handling divorce and custody cases for years and places intense focus and attention on every client he works with. While most cases do not go to trial, Chris knows the importance of being ready for trial should it become necessary.

After successfully handling many divorce and custody matters Chris has received numerous awards related to his prior clients' satisfaction with his work. He has been named a top 100 Trial Lawyer in the State of Texas by the National Trial Lawyers. Further, he has consistently been named one of the Top Ten Texas Family Law Attorneys under 40 by the National Association of Family Law Attorneys.

Chris frequently handles highly contested property matters, including but not limited to: claims of separate property and divorces involving business interests.

For custody matters, Chris has successfully represented Fathers, Mothers and even Grandparents in highly contested cases. As a father himself, Chris takes seriously a parent's most precious gift: time with their child.

Chris graduated with honors from Baylor Law School, was a member of the Baylor Law Review, and finished in the top 10% of his graduating class.

Chris clerked at the international law firm of Norton Rose Fulbright (formerly Fulbright & Jaworski, LLP) in San Antonio as well as Scott, Douglass, & McConnico, LLP located in Austin, Texas. Chris also interned for Federal Judge Walter S. Smith in Waco, Texas and Valero Energy Corp., the largest refiner in the United States.

Chris' areas of practice include Divorce, Custody, Child Support, Family Violence, and other Family law matters.
